Differences in rate and variability of intracellular growth of a panel of Mycobacterium tuberculosis clinical isolates within a human monocyte model.

Abstract

Significant differences were observed in the capacities of Mycobacterium tuberculosis clinical isolates to grow within human monocytes. Genotyping indicated that the four most rapidly growing isolates were members of the Beijing strain family. M. tuberculosis strain H37Rv provided more reproducible infection than the clinical isolates or M. tuberculosis Erdman.
